Education Maintenance Allowance (EMA)

Education Maintenance Allowance (EMA) is available to students who will have reached their sixteenth birthday after 1st March 2010 and decided to stay on at school from August 2010. It is a weekly allowance based on attendance. The EMA is means tested.

Important Announcement

We have today received confirmation from the Scottish Government regarding EMA for the new 2010-2011 session. An extract from their announcement follows:

“The current economic climate led to more young people staying in learning last session, with significant increased demand for EMA.

We expect a similar level of demand next academic year and for this reason we have had to take steps to manage that additional demand within the resources we have available. These include making adjustments to the EMA programme in 2010 – 11.

The first change is that, from academic year 2010-11, bonus payments will no longer be part of the programme.

The second is that, given the anticipated pressures on the budget this financial year, we will review the EMA programme in December 2010 and consider whether further adjustments are needed.

Any awards issued to young people for academic year 2010-11 are therefore only guaranteed until December. I fully appreciate that the mid-year review point may cause additional work for your staff and uncertainty both for staff and young people.”
